Importance of Play-Based Learning

Play is essential for young learners. It's not just fun and games; it's a valuable resource for developing important skills. Through play, children discover the world around them, make friends, and think outside the box. Play-based learning encourages exploration and helps children become confident learners.

When children are engaged in play, they are more motivated to learn. Play-based learning also helps children develop important intellectual capacities such as decision making. It also promotes social and emotional development. By encouraging imaginative activities, we can help children become successful learners.

Empowering Children Through Inclusive Education

Inclusive education is a vital approach for nurturing the full potential of every child. By creating classrooms that are welcoming and inclusive to all learners, regardless of their abilities, we can motivate children to succeed.

An inclusive educational environment recognizes the individuality of each student and provides tailored support to help them attain their goals. This can encompass a range of methods, such as collaborative learning, learning aids, and mentorship for educators.

Through inclusive education, we can overcome limitations and create a more fair society where all children have the opportunity to participate fully.
